Errm. What kind of graphics are you talking about? Freelancer is a closed-source software, hence it's impossible to fiddle directly with rendering engine. Higher resolution texture and higher polygonal ships come at cost of performance and from what I've seen Freelancer rendering isn't handling that kind of strain well enough. Since Freelancer doesn't precache ships every time you see a ship that you haven't seen in the current game session it will automatically load, mesh, textures and everything, it takes time and as a result makes player lag. Lack of mesh LODs and texture mipmaps forces game to load full model and texture(s), and that's even more time. Now if you jump into system where nearby a battle takes place with various ships you will probably die before your computer loads them all into memory. I would rather encourage ship makers do LODs first, not to mention using DXT compressed DDS with mipmaps instead of zero level mipmap uncompressed TGAs, and generally reuse existing material instead of making unnecessary new textures. Typically graphical enhancements such as new effects can happen for games that have engine source released, which isn't the case here unfortunately... or fortunately, depends on how you look on it, at least being old game Freelancer can appeal to players who even have low-end systems, hence being more accessible to audience.
